Finding the Right Psychiatrist for ADHD: A Comprehensive Guide
Attention Deficit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ental condition that affects both kids and adults. It is defined by symptoms such as in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ity, which can significantly affect day-to-day life. For lots of individuals, seeking expert assistance from a psychiatrist is a crucial step in handling ADHD effectively. This post supplies an extensive guide on how to find the ideal psychiatrist for ADHD, consisting of ideas, FAQs, and a list of crucial factors to consider.
Understanding ADHD and the Role of a Psychiatrist
ADHD is a complex condition that can manifest in a different way in each individual. Common signs include problem focusing, restlessness, and spontaneous behavior. While these symptoms can be managed through various methods, including medication, therapy, and way of life modifications, a psychiatrist plays a vital function in detecting and treating ADHD.

A psychiatrist is a medical doctor who concentrates on mental health. They are qualified to prescribe medication, supply therapy, and use a holistic method to treatment. For people with ADHD, a psychiatrist can:
Diagnose ADHD: Conduct a comprehensive evaluation to figure out if ADHD is the underlying concern.Establish a Treatment Plan: Create an individualized treatment plan that might consist of medication, therapy, and way of life recommendations.Screen Progress: Regularly assess the effectiveness of the treatment and make adjustments as needed.Supply Support: Offer ongoing support and assistance to assist people manage their signs and enhance their lifestyle.Actions to Find the Right Psychiatrist for ADHD
Research and Recommendations
Request Referrals: Start by asking your main care doctor, therapist, or other doctor for suggestions.Online Directories: Use online directory sites such as the American Psychiatric Association (APA) or Psychology Today to find psychiatrists in your area.Insurance coverage Provider: Check with your insurance coverage provider for a list of in-network psychiatrists.
Consider Specialization
ADHD Expertise: Look for psychiatrists who specialize in ADHD or have substantial experience dealing with the condition.Age Group: If you are looking for a psychiatrist for a child, guarantee they have experience dealing with pediatric patients.
Inspect Credentials and Reviews
Board Certification: Verify that the psychiatrist is board-certified by the American Board of Psychiatry and Neurology (ABPN).Patient Reviews: Read online evaluations and reviews from existing and previous patients to get an idea of their experience.
Preliminary Consultation
First Visit: Schedule an initial consultation to discuss your symptoms, medical history, and treatment goals.Interaction Style: Pay attention to how the psychiatrist interacts with you. They should be understanding, educated, and ready to listen to your issues.
Treatment Approach
Holistic Care: Look for a psychiatrist who takes a holistic method to treatment, considering all aspects of your life, consisting of physical health, emotional wellness, and lifestyle.Medication Management: Discuss the psychiatrist's technique to medication management and how they will monitor its effectiveness.
Location and Availability
Convenience: Consider the area of the psychiatrist's workplace and whether it is easily accessible.Schedule: Ensure the psychiatrist has schedule that fits your schedule, consisting of evening or weekend visits if necessary.FAQs About Finding a Psychiatrist for ADHD
Q: What should I anticipate during the first see to a psychiatrist for ADHD?
A: The very first go to normally includes a comprehensive evaluation, which may consist of a detailed discussion of your signs, medical history, and any previous treatments. The psychiatrist might also carry out psychological tests to validate the medical diagnosis. This check out is likewise a chance for you to ask questions and discuss your treatment objectives.
Q: How do I know if a psychiatrist is an excellent fit for me?
A: An excellent fit is somebody who listens to your issues, communicates plainly, and makes you feel comfortable. You should feel positive in their know-how and trust their judgment. If you have any doubts, it's all right to seek a 2nd opinion.
Q: What are the typical medications used to deal with ADHD?
A: Common medications for ADHD include stimulants (such as methylphenidate and amphetamines) and non-stimulants (such as atomoxetine). The option of medication depends upon the individual's specific symptoms and case history.
Q: Can a psychiatrist provide therapy in addition to medication?
A: Yes, many psychiatrists offer therapy in addition to medication management. However, some might refer you to a psychologist or therapist for extra assistance.
Q: How long does it require to see enhancement with ADHD treatment?
A: The time it requires to see enhancement differs from person to person. Some individuals may discover a difference within a few weeks, while others might take numerous months. Regular follow-up visits are necessary to keep track of progress and adjust the treatment strategy as required.
